Feeling Stuck As An Entrepreneur? Here's How To Get Unstuck In Any Business Situation!

By: Stephanie J Hale

Think of all the people you would really, truly trust with anything. It's probably a very short list. You may have a spouse or best friend, sibling, or other family member on that list - but are YOU on it? Do you trust the thoughts which surface in your own mind?





One of the keys to success is learning to trust your own instinct. Entrepreneur Jennifer Hough, who is founder of The Vital You, the largest holistic nutrition clinic in Canada, believes one of the biggest road blocks to success is not listening to your own heart.

"It's not trusting their intuition," Hough says. "Listening to the book and the people outside of themselves rather than actually listening to the call of their heart, knowing that their heart is God's megaphone. Who better to believe than omnipotence? You're a cosmic support team."

Jennifer is one of 12 millionaires from around the world I've interviewed for my new book. They all say a similar thing: it's essential to get in touch with your intuition. Trust what you feel - even if you can't quite put it into words or make logical sense of it.

We all have about a million thoughts in our head at any given time. Often it might seem as if those thoughts are competing against each other or contradicting each other. But what those thoughts are really all about is getting you to fulfill your purpose.

What does your instinct tell you to do right now? Just take the very first thought that comes to mind. Don't fight it, and don't get distracted. Just grab the first thing that comes to mind. That first thing is your priority. Whatever you thought of first is something you need to do.

If it's complicated, then map out a way to get there if you need to, but make sure you keep your priority. If you trust your instinct, you'll always be in the right place at the right time.
